Merge tag 'nfs-for-5.7-1' of git://git.linux-nfs.org/projects/trondmy/linux-nfs
Pull NFS client updates from Trond Myklebust:
"Highlights include:
Stable fixes:
- Fix a page leak in nfs_destroy_unlinked_subrequests()
- Fix use-after-free issues in nfs_pageio_add_request()
- Fix new mount code constant_table array definitions
- finish_automount() requires us to hold 2 refs to the mount record
Features:
- Improve the accuracy of telldir/seekdir by using 64-bit cookies
when possible.
- Allow one RDMA active connection and several zombie connections to
prevent blocking if the remote server is unresponsive.
- Limit the size of the NFS access cache by default
- Reduce the number of references to credentials that are taken by
NFS
- pNFS files and flexfiles drivers now support per-layout segment
COMMIT lists.
- Enable partial-file layout segments in the pNFS/flexfiles driver.
- Add support for CB_RECALL_ANY to the pNFS flexfiles layout type
- pNFS/flexfiles Report NFS4ERR_DELAY and NFS4ERR_GRACE errors from
the DS using the layouterror mechanism.
Bugfixes and cleanups:
- SUNRPC: Fix krb5p regressions
- Don't specify NFS version in "UDP not supported" error
- nfsroot: set tcp as the default transport protocol
- pnfs: Return valid stateids in nfs_layout_find_inode_by_stateid()
- alloc_nfs_open_context() must use the file cred when available
- Fix locking when dereferencing the delegation cred
- Fix memory leaks in O_DIRECT when nfs_get_lock_context() fails
- Various clean ups of the NFS O_DIRECT commit code
- Clean up RDMA connect/disconnect
- Replace zero-length arrays with C99-style flexible arrays"
